Stocks Report: 27th and 28th of July

Date:    27th and 28th July
Report Author:    Matthew
Best Catch:    Several 5 bag limits
Heaviest Bag:    5 fish for 11lb 12oz
Best Rainbow:    3lb for Joan Lindsay
Best Brownie:    3lb for Mark Tyndall
Best Blue:    2lb for Ian Greenwood
Bank Rod Av:    1.50
Boat Rod Av:    2.50
Sport:  Although the past couple of days have been a little quiet I just thought it was worth mentioning that the fish are still up in the water chasing. Although Mark |Tyndall only had 4 fish on Monday he did get a treble hook up! Three brown trout on one cast! Mark was pulling an orange blob booby with the traditional patterns on the point.  Regular Ged Oxley had 3 good fish from Bell point all coming to black fritz patterns. Scores of 3 and four have been the norm and I’m sure that with some settled weather them averages will go straight up.
On another note another Stocks Bowlander team has qualified for an International grand final! Our Peter and the Stocks Barracudas finished 5th just piping Ben and the falcons by 7oz!!
A good year so far for Stocks on the competition scene, It is so easy to get involved and success can see you fishing at some other great venues throughout the country, not to mention more time out on our water! There is a good fun pair’s competition on the 23rd of August that may just wet your appetite. Just give me a call at the lodge for more information.
Overall though despite some lousy weather the fish are still up and chasing, and indeed still taking the dry fly.
Tight lines Matthew.
